Examines whether there is room within a traditional religious education for secular studies. This book supports the argument that a mixture of traditional religion and worldly knowledge is not only acceptable, but recommended. It examines the ideas of Maimonides, Samson Raphael Hirsch, and Abraham Isaac Kook.
